Definition: A yard (symbol: yd) is a unit of length in both the imperial and US customary systems of measurement. Since 1959, a yard has been defined as exactly 0.9144 meters. It is also equal to 3 feet, or 36 inches. History/origin: The origin of the yard as a unit is unclear. It is an English unit (predecessor of imperial units) and the term was derived from "gerd" in Old English, the ...How many linear feet in 1 yard? The answer is 3. Square foot. Definition: A square foot (symbol: sq ft) is a unit of area used in the imperial and US customary systems (UCS). It is defined as the area of a square with one-foot sides. One square foot equals 144 square inches. History/origin: The origin of the square foot can be seen in the term itself. What does 100 linear feet mean? 100 linear feet is a straight line measurement used to describe the length of an item, like a boat or the distance between two points.1 m = 3.28084 ft, 1 m / 3.28084 ft = 1. We can write the conversion as: 1 ft 2 = 1 ft 2 * (1 m / 3.28084 ft) * (1 m / 3.28084 ft) = 0.0929030 m 2. And we now have our factor for conversion from ft 2 to m 2 since 1 * 0.0929030 = 0.0929030. Note that there are rounding errors in this value. The value in the table, 0.09290304, is more accurate.

Where L is the linear feet remaining on the roll and W is the weight of ...A linear meter is a meter length from a roll of fabric. Usually in Europe the width of the roll is 1.46m, so a linear meter is an oblong 1m x 1.46m. So (in this particular example): 1 x Linear Meter = 1.46 square metersOne.
